Frontend Angular information

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a frontend Angular developer?

To thrive as a Frontend Angular Developer, you need strong proficiency in JavaScript, TypeScript, HTML, CSS, and a solid understanding of Angular frameworks, often supported by a degree in computer science or related field.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, RESTful APIs, and tools such as Angular CLI and testing frameworks is typically required. Excellent probl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help developers collaborate and deliver high-quality user interfaces. These skills and qualities are essential for building responsive, maintainable, and scalable web applications that meet user needs and business goals.

Frontend Angular and Frontend React are both popular JavaScript frameworks used for building web interfaces. Angular offers a comprehensive, opinionated structure suitable for large-scale enterprise applications, while React provides a flexible, component-based approach favored by startups and tech companies. The choice depends on project requirements, team expertise, and industry preferences.

How does a frontend Angular developer typically collaborate with backend teams during a project?

Frontend Angular developers frequently work closely with backend teams to ensure seamless integration between user interfaces and server-side logic. Collaboration often involves regular meetings to clarify API requirements, discuss data structures, and troubleshoot integration issues as they arise. Effective communication and the use of shared documentation or tools like Swagger can help both teams align on endpoints and data formats. By fostering a collaborative environment, frontend and backend developers can deliver cohesive, high-quality applications that meet user and business needs.

What is a frontend Angular developer?

Frontend Angular developers are software engineers who specialize in building the user-facing parts of web applications using the Angular framework. They design and implement interactive interfaces, ensuring that web pages are responsive, efficient, and visually appealing. Their work often involves collaborating with backend developers, UX/UI designers, and other team members to deliver seamless web experiences. Proficiency in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and Angular is essential for this role. They may also be responsible for optimizing application performance and maintaining code quality.
